Event description
Employee killed when struck by falling tree
Investigation abstract
At approximately 5:45 p.m. on August 16, 1988, Employee #1 was felling the last tree of the day at a remote logging site approximately 9 miles from a paved road . The tree, a hardwood yellow birch, 21 inches at the stump, fell as intended, b ut struck a 12 inch softwood fir tree. The top of the fir tree (12 to 15 ft) sna pped off 25 to 30 feet above the ground and fell, striking Employee #1 on the he ad and chest and pinning him to the ground. Employee #1 died of massive internal injuries several hours later, en route to, or at, the Coldbrook, NH, hospital.
